Ministry of Foreign Affairs Launches Initiative to Switch to Electronic Visas and QR Codes

Al-Marsad Newspaper: The Ministry of Foreign Affairs launched a new initiative to cancel the visa sticker on the beneficiary’s passport and switch to the electronic visa and read its data via a quick response (QR) code.

This comes within the framework of completing procedures for automating and raising the quality of consular services provided by the Ministry by developing a mechanism for granting visas (work, residence, and visit).

This procedure was activated as a first stage in a number of the Kingdom’s missions in the following countries: (UAE, Jordan, Egypt, Bangladesh, India, Indonesia, and the Philippines).
